What is Vmrun?

You can use vmrun to perform various tasks on virtual machines, summarized below. Power Commands. Virtual machine power operations give you these options: start (power on), stop (power off), reset (reboot), suspend (but allow local work to resume), pause (without interrupting), and unpause (continue).

Where is Vmrun?

Assuming that a standard installation is performed, the vmrun executable is located in \Program Files\VMware\VMware Server on Windows hosts and /usr/bin on Linux. The https URL of the host to which vmrun is required to connect.

What is VMware CMD?

vmware-cmd provides an interface to perform operations on a virtual machine. You can retrieve information such as the power state, register and unregister the virtual machine, set configuration variables, and manage snapshots.

What is the difference between VMware and VMware Player?

VMware Workstation Player and VMware Workstation Pro are virtualization applications that users can run on their desktop or laptops. VMware Workstation Player is free to use, whereas the VMware Workstation Pro requires a license. Both run on top of the Windows or Linux host Operating System.

Where the VM files are stored on VMware ESXi?

In VMware Workstation or VMware ACE, the default location of virtual machine files is the directory /home/username/vmware , where username is the user who created the virtual machine. In VMware Server, the default location of virtual machine files is the directory /var/lib/vmware/Virtual Machines .

How do I run a VMware virtual machine automatically?

AutoStart

  1. Right-click Shared VMs/Server Name/IP Address.
  2. Select Manage AutoStart VMs.
  3. Select the virtual machines that you want to auto start.
  4. Set the delay that you want for the virtual machine in the Delay between starting each virtual machine (in seconds) option available at the bottom of the window.

Can VMware workstation run as a service?

VMware Workstation Server can run in background as a service and allows you to configure VMs to start automatically (after a host machine on which VMware Workstation has been installed is booted, without the need for the user to log in to the operating system manually).

What are the limitations of VMware Player?

In both VMware Workstation Player and VMware Workstation Pro, you are free to create powerful virtual machines (64 GB RAM, 16 virtual processors, and 3 GB VRAM). If the guest OS has a 32-bit architecture, it cannot use more than 4 GB of RAM in most cases – this is one of the limitations of the 32-bit architecture.

Is VMware Player still free?

The free version is available for non-commercial, personal and home use. We also encourage students and non-profit organizations to benefit from this offering. Commercial organizations require commercial licenses to use Workstation Player.

What is CLI VMware?

Overview: The vSphere Command-Line Interface (vSphere CLI) command set allows you to run common system administration commands against ESXi systems from any machine with network access to those systems.
